Linux下安装redis
作者:CP7
链接:https://www.jianshu.com/p/bc84b2b71c1c
一、安装redis
下面介绍在Linux环境下,Redis的安装与部署,使用redis-3.0稳定版,因为redis从3.0开始增加了集群功能。
1.可以通过官网下载 地址:http://download.redis.io/releases/redis-3.0.0.tar.gz
2.使用linux wget命令
wget http://download.redis.io/releases/redis-3.0.0.tar.gz
3.将redis-3.0.0.tar.gz拷贝到/usr/local下
cp redis-3.0.0.rar.gz /usr/local
4.解压源码
tar -zxvf redis-3.0.0.tar.gz
cd /usr/local/redis-3.0.0
make PREFIX=/usr/local/redis install
redis.conf是redis的配置文件,redis.conf在redis源码目录。
7.拷贝配置文件到安装目录下
进入源码目录,里面有一份配置文件 redis.conf,然后将其拷贝到安装路径下
cd /usr/local/redis cp /usr/local/redis-3.0.0/redis.conf /usr/local/redis/bin
cd /usr/local/redis/bin
![](http://upload-images.jianshu.io/upload_images/5145552-5e2339176d6a2d63.png?imageMogr2/auto-orient/strip|imageView2/2/w/752/format/webp)
redis-benchmark redis性能测试工具
redis-check-aof AOF文件修复工具
redis-check-rdb RDB文件修复工具
redis-cli redis命令行客户端
redis.conf redis配置文件
redis-sentinal redis集群管理工具
redis-server redis服务进程
二.启动redis与连接
1.前端模式启动
直接运行bin/redis-server将以前端模式启动,前端模式启动的缺点是ssh命令窗口关闭则redis-server程序结束,不推荐使用此方法,如图:
./redis-server
![](http://upload-images.jianshu.io/upload_images/5145552-a3bbd113c8131572.png?imageMogr2/auto-orient/strip|imageView2/2/w/1200/format/webp)
2.后端模式启动
1.修改redis.conf配置文件, daemonize yes 以后端模式启动
vim /usr/local/redis/bin/redis.conf
![](http://upload-images.jianshu.io/upload_images/5145552-6e99ad064ae73055.png?imageMogr2/auto-orient/strip|imageView2/2/w/796/format/webp)
2.执行如下命令启动redis:
cd /usr/local/redis
./bin/redis-server ./bin/redis.conf
3.本地连接redis
cd /usr/local/redis/
./bin/redis-cli
4.关闭redis
强行终止redis进程可能会导致redis持久化数据丢失。正确停止Redis的方式应该是向Redis发送SHUTDOWN命令,命令为:
cd /usr/local/redis
./bin/redis-cli shutdown
5.强行终止redis
pkill redis-server
6.让redis开机自启
vim /etc/rc.local //添加 /usr/local/redis/bin/redis-server /usr/local/redis/etc/redis-conf
相关文章
- linux下redis的安装和集群搭建
- Redis学习(5)-Jedis(Java操作redis数据库技术)
- Redis学习(2)-redis安装
- Linux系统安装NoSQL(MongoDB和Redis)步骤及问题解决办法
- linux(ubuntu 21.10): php8.0.14:安装phpredis以访问redis(phpredis-5.3.5)
- Redis-Cluster实战--5.使用redis-cli安装
- Linux随笔(安装ftp,安装jdk,安装 tomcat,安装redis,安装MySQL,安装svn)
- Linux 编写简单驱动并测试
- Linux 下面解压zip、.tar.gz 和.gz文件解压的方式
- linux安装redis汇总
- 【面试】Linux面试题
- 〖Python 数据库开发实战 - Redis篇②〗- Linux系统下安装 Redis 数据库
- [手游项目3]-17-linux下redis
- 【编程实践】Linux下的同步IO :sync、fsync与 fdatasync
- L82.linux命令每日一练 -- 第11章 Linux系统管理命令 -- dmidecode和lspci
- L74.linux命令每日一练 -- 第十章 Linux网络管理命令 -- nmap和tcpdump
- L69.linux命令每日一练 -- 第十章 Linux网络管理命令 -- arpping和telnet
- 02 从头开始atac项目 ubuntu20 install r4.2 Linux系统环境配置 服务器版本的rstudio r install in linux /ubuntu/centos
- linux===给新手的 10 个有用 Linux 命令行技巧(转)
- Linux系列 linux 常用命令(笔记)
- 【C++ 科学计算】redis-plus-plus:安装用C ++编写的Redis客户端
- 使用redis-shake工具迁移云Redis数据(二十一)